Rebecca W. Desrosiers of Grassy Creek passed away into the arms of our Savior, Jesus Christ, on March 12, 2018. She was born in Oxford, North Carolina on August 29, 1953.

Rebecca fought a two-year battle with AML leukemia trying every therapy possible. During her fight, Rebecca’s treatment included several research protocols. Her participation in these protocols resulted in medical breakthroughs that will benefit future leukemia patients.

She is survived by her husband of 43 years, Dr. Paul M. Desrosiers, by her godchildren, Rebecca Ascencio and Paul Pelayo, her sister, Jean Marie Borst, brother-in-law, Col. Howard Borst, niece, Lauren Marie, and parents, Charlie David and Eunice Winston, and Laura Ascencio.

Rebecca married Paul, the love of her life in 1975, and they were blessed with raising two godchildren and their namesakes, Rebecca Ascencio and Paul Pelayo. Rebecca and Paul met in Granville County while they were working at Granville Medical Center. She and Paul delighted in traveling the world giving their godchildren a perspective and appreciation for different cultures, customs, and traditions.

Rebecca graduated from Eastern Carolina University with a nursing degree. She worked as an active registered nurse, among other things, caring for patients and teaching childbirth education in dual languages. During her career, she helped countless patients without the financial wherewithal for basic medical treatment.

Rebecca lived a selfless life focused entirely on helping others. She has supported and assisted many families along the way. She has always fought and argued for the less fortunate and has been ready to help no matter the cost. Her impact and presence will always be felt because she has imparted and bestowed so much of her life on family, friends, and anyone that came across her path.

There will be a memorial service on Friday, March 23, 2018, at 2:00 p.m. at Grassy Creek Baptist Church. Interment will follow in the church burial grounds. Rev. Cameron Currin will be officiating the service.
